System Not Heating or Cooling at All in Burnet

Complete failure to heat or cool is the most urgent HVAC symptom with the broadest range of possible causes in Burnet, TX. On the cooling side: failed compressor, refrigerant leak, failed condenser fan, or electrical fault preventing outdoor unit startup in Burnet. On the heating side: failed igniter, failed flame sensor, cracked heat exchanger, gas valve fault, or heat pump reversing valve issue in Burnet, TX.

HVAC Running Continuously Without Reaching Setpoint in Burnet, TX

A system that runs but fails to reach the thermostat setpoint has a capacity or efficiency problem in Burnet. Low refrigerant reducing cooling or heating capacity. Dirty condenser coils reducing efficiency. Contaminated heat exchanger. Or duct system leakage delivering conditioned air to unconditioned spaces in Burnet, TX.

Short Cycling — Turning On and Off Too Frequently in Burnet

Short cycling produces wear on every major HVAC component at an accelerated rate because startup is the most stressful moment in any component's operating cycle in Burnet, TX. A failing capacitor. A high-limit switch tripping from restricted airflow. An incorrect refrigerant charge. Or an oversized system satisfying the thermostat before completing a full conditioning cycle in Burnet.

Unusual Noises From Any Part of the HVAC System in Burnet, TX

Every HVAC sound maps to a specific developing fault in Burnet. Grinding or squealing from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Burnet, TX. Banging or booming at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Burnet. Rattling from the outdoor unit indicates debris or a loose component in Burnet, TX. Hissing or bubbling indicates refrigerant escaping through a leak in Burnet.

HVAC Tripping Circuit Breakers or Blowing Fuses in Burnet

An HVAC system that consistently trips its circuit breaker is drawing more current than the circuit is rated for in Burnet, TX. A failing compressor drawing locked rotor current at startup. A failing blower motor drawing excessive current. A capacitor fault causing motors to draw excessive starting current. Or a short circuit in the electrical wiring or control system in Burnet.

Uneven Temperatures Throughout the Home in Burnet, TX

Rooms consistently hotter or colder than others despite consistent thermostat settings have a distribution problem in Burnet. Duct leakage or damage reducing conditioned air delivery to specific zones. Blocked or restricted supply registers in affected rooms. A blower operating at reduced capacity from contamination. Or zoning system faults in Burnet, TX.

Higher Than Expected Energy Bills From the HVAC in Burnet

An HVAC consuming more energy than it should for the conditioning it produces has a specific efficiency problem in Burnet, TX. Contaminated blower wheel reducing airflow. Dirty condenser coils reducing heat rejection. Low refrigerant reducing system efficiency. Or duct leakage in Burnet.

How a Single Fault Creates Secondary Stress on Adjacent Components in Burnet, TX

A failing capacitor causes the compressor to draw locked rotor current at startup, heating the compressor motor windings and accelerating insulation breakdown in Burnet. If the capacitor is not replaced, the compressor continues this abnormal startup pattern and eventually fails from the accumulated thermal stress in Burnet, TX. A failed condenser fan causes the condenser coil to overheat, raising head pressure in the refrigerant circuit and stressing the compressor in Burnet. In each case, the initial component failure creates conditions that produce secondary failure if the initial fault is not corrected promptly in Burnet, TX.

What Professional Diagnostic Equipment Identifies in Burnet, TX

Refrigerant gauges measure the suction and discharge pressure in the refrigerant circuit, revealing refrigerant charge level and compressor performance in Burnet. Electrical meters measure voltage, amperage, and resistance at every electrical component, identifying failing capacitors, contactors, and motor windings in Burnet, TX. Combustion analyzers confirm complete combustion and identify heat exchanger faults in Burnet. Airflow meters measure supply and return airflow, identifying duct, coil, and blower performance issues in Burnet, TX.
